Nigeria's Healthcare Crisis: Quacks, Charlatans, and the Quest for Real Hope
Nigeria's healthcare system is facing a dual crisis: inadequate healthcare infrastructure and a rampant epidemic of medical quackery. While the country struggles to provide quality healthcare to its citizens, unqualified individuals and charlatans are preying on the vulnerable, peddling fake treatments and cures.
The Rise of Medical Quackery
Medical quackery has become a lucrative
business in Nigeria, with fake doctors, herbalists, and spiritualists claiming
to cure everything from cancer to HIV/AIDS. These charlatans often use
persuasive marketing tactics, false testimonials, and fake credentials to gain
the trust of their victims.
The Consequences of Quackery
The consequences of medical quackery are devastating. Patients who seek help from quacks often experience delayed diagnosis, inappropriate treatment, and worsening of their condition. In some cases, quackery can be fatal, as patients succumb to treatable conditions that are left untreated or mistreated.
Why Quackery Thrives in Nigeria
Several factors contribute to the
proliferation of medical quackery in Nigeria. These include:
·
Lack of Effective Regulation: Inadequate regulation and enforcement of healthcare standards
enable quacks to operate with impunity.
·
Poverty and Desperation: Many Nigerians are desperate for solutions to their health
problems and may turn to quacks out of frustration or lack of access to quality
healthcare.
·
Lack of Health Education: Limited health education and awareness among the population make it
easier for quacks to deceive and exploit people.
